当前位置 主页 > 技术大全 >

    Xshell与Navicat:高效远程管理秘籍
    xshell navicat

    栏目:技术大全 时间:2024-12-05 14:51



    Xshell与Navicat:高效运维与数据库管理的双刃剑 在信息化高速发展的今天,服务器管理和数据库操作成为了企业运维工作中不可或缺的一环

        面对复杂多变的网络环境以及海量数据的处理需求,选择一款高效、稳定、易用的工具显得尤为重要

        在众多同类产品中,Xshell与Navicat凭借其卓越的性能、丰富的功能以及良好的用户体验,成为了众多运维工程师和数据库管理员的首选利器

        本文将深入探讨Xshell与Navicat的特点、优势以及它们如何协同工作,共同提升运维与数据库管理的效率

         一、Xshell:远程服务器的掌控者 Xshell是一款功能强大的终端仿真软件,主要用于远程访问和管理Linux、Unix、Windows等操作系统的服务器

        它以其简洁的界面、流畅的操作体验以及强大的功能集,赢得了广大运维人员的青睐

         1. 高效便捷的远程连接 Xshell支持SSH、SFTP、TELNET等多种协议,用户只需简单配置即可轻松连接到远程服务器

        其强大的会话管理功能允许用户保存多个服务器的连接信息,一键切换,大大提高了工作效率

        同时,Xshell还支持多标签页功能,用户可以在一个窗口内同时打开多个终端,实现多任务并行处理

         2. 强大的脚本与自动化功能 对于需要频繁执行的任务,Xshell提供了脚本执行功能

        用户可以将一系列命令编写成脚本文件,通过Xshell一键执行,实现自动化操作

        这不仅减少了重复劳动,还降低了人为操作失误的风险

        此外,Xshell还支持宏录制功能,用户可以将一系列鼠标操作录制成宏,随时调用,进一步提升工作效率

         3. 丰富的插件与扩展性 Xshell拥有丰富的插件生态系统,用户可以根据自己的需求安装各种插件,扩展软件功能

        比如,通过安装Xshell的SFTP插件,用户可以直接在Xshell内实现文件的上传下载操作,无需切换到其他工具

        这种高度的可扩展性使得Xshell能够满足不同用户的个性化需求

         二、Navicat:数据库管理的瑞士军刀 Navicat是一款功能全面的数据库管理工具,支持MySQL、MariaDB、MongoDB、Oracle、PostgreSQL、SQLite等多种数据库类型

        它以直观的用户界面、丰富的功能以及高效的数据处理能力,成为了数据库管理员的得力助手

         1. 直观易用的图形界面 Navicat采用了直观的图形用户界面设计,用户无需具备深厚的数据库知识即可轻松上手

        通过简单的拖放操作,用户可以快速创建、修改数据库对象(如表、视图、索引等),以及执行SQL查询

        此外,Navicat还提供了丰富的数据可视化工具,如数据图表、数据导出向导等,使得数据分析和处理变得更加直观便捷

         2. 高效的数据迁移与同步 在数据库管理过程中,数据迁移与同步是常见的需求

        Navicat提供了强大的数据迁移与同步功能,支持跨数据库类型的数据转换和同步操作

        用户只需简单配置源数据库和目标数据库的信息,即可实现数据的自动迁移和同步,大大简化了操作流程,降低了出错率

         3. 强大的安全管理与备份恢复 数据库的安全性是企业信息化建设的重中之重

        Navicat提供了多种安全机制,如数据加密、访问控制等,确保数据库的安全运行

        同时,Navicat还支持数据库的备份与恢复操作,用户可以根据自己的需求制定备份计划,实现数据库的定期备份

        在发生数据丢失或损坏时,用户可以迅速通过备份文件恢复数据库,保障业务的连续性

         三、Xshell与Navicat的协同作战 在实际运维工作中,Xshell与Navicat往往不是孤立存在的,而是相互协作,共同构建了一个高效、稳定的运维管理体系

         1. 远程服务器与数据库的无缝对接 通过Xshell,运维人员可以轻松连接到远程服务器,进行系统的日常维护和监控

        当需要访问或管理数据库时,运维人员可以直接在Xshell的终端中执行数据库命令,或者通过SSH隧道将Navicat连接到远程数据库服务器,实现远程数据库管理

        这种无缝对接的方式避免了频繁切换工具的麻烦,提高了工作效率

         2. 数据迁移与同步的自动化 在数据迁移或同步过程中,运维人员可以先通过Xshell登录到源数据库服务器,进行数据导出操作

        然后,利用Navicat的数据迁移与同步功能,将导出的数据导入到目标数据库服务器中

        这种结合使用的方式不仅提高了数据迁移的效率和准确性,还降低了操作难度和复杂度

         3. 高效的问题排查与故障处理 当服务器或数据库出现故障时,运维人员可以通过Xshell快速登录到故障服务器进行问题排查

        同时,利用Navicat的数据库监控和日志分析功能,可以迅速定位故障原因并采取相应的处理措施

        这种协同作战的方式大大提高了故障处理的效率和准确性,确保了业务的稳定运行

         四、结语 综上所述,Xshell与Navicat作为运维与数据库管理的两大利器,各自在远程服务器管理和数据库操作方面发挥着不可替代的作用

        它们不仅功能强大、操作便捷,而且具有良好的扩展性和兼容性,能够满足不同用户的个性化需求

        通过协同作战,Xshell与Navicat共同构建了一个高效、稳定、易用的运维管理体系,为企业的信息化建设提供了有力的支持

        在未来的发展中,随着技术的不断进步和用户需求的不断变化,Xshell与Navicat将继续优化升级,为企业运维与数据库管理领域带来更多的创新和惊喜

        

    下一篇:没有了